BREAKING: A federal judge in the Eastern District of Virginia has issued a preliminary injunction halting the Trump administration's $1.8 billion "anti-weaponization" fund for one week, giving the government time to sign a "clear, unambiguous" agreement that the fund is dead.

US District Judge Richard Leon just denied a temporary restraining order on Trump's "anti-weaponization" fund in DC District Court, saying the matter is moot. He cited statements by Blanche and in govt court filings that fund is not moving forward.

Inflation is so high that it's erasing all wage gains. Inflation: 4.2% in May for the past year Wage growth: 3.4% in May for the past year. Americans are getting squeezed financially. This isn't just "bad vibes" about the economy. There is real pain, especially for middle-class and lower-income households. It's tough because so many basic items are seeing sizable price increases: gas, electricity, food, medical care.

House votes 214-212 to send Trump a nearly $70 billion spending package for ICE, CBP and the DHS secretary. California independent Rep. Kevin Kiley, who conferences with Republicans, voted no, along with Democrats.

House votes 213-211 to approve the rule that sets up debate and a final passage vote later today on Republicans' nearly $70 billion funding package for ICE, Border Patrol and the DHS Secretary.
